Transaction 126de80c97cfb816ded1eb5946043e248732f8fa9b204126bcd8e3bfaba70043
1 Input
1 Output
-
126de80c97cfb816ded1eb5946043e248732f8fa9b204126bcd8e3bfaba70043:0
- value
- 437286
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4855b832574556df140985a69c9561523bdecc22 OP_EQUAL
- address
- 38HVGFaFAn6WdeYQsinhqEu61eo8fmGbV3